Page 82 - 智慧芯控——Arduino+智造
P. 82
活动 B:实现智能跟随
活动目标
1. 了解红外避障传感器的工作原理和应用。
2. 了解马达驱动机器的应用。
3. 设计智能跟随的算法并编写程序。
活动简介
首先,在活动 A 已经制作好的小车的基础上,将 Arduino 开发板、马达驱动板、马达、
电池和红外避障传感器进行正确合理的电路连接;其次,设计合理的机器人跟随策略,编
写程序代码并调试,实现智能跟随功能。
活动器材
Arduino 板、马达驱动板、红外避障传感器、11V 锂电池、双轴马达、轮胎、2mm 厚环氧板、
杜邦导线、魔术贴等、美工刀、热胶枪、胶棒、绝缘黑胶带、螺丝刀等。
安全事项
使用热胶枪时,热胶适量即可,不宜过多;在连接电路时,一定要注意正确连接电源
正负极,注意不要接反了;首次开启电源前,务必检查电源的正负极。
活动准备
Arduino 开发板和直流电机驱动板连接组成驱动马达的电路,Arduino 开发板和红外避
障传感器连接组成数据采集的电路。
活动步骤
连接电路 程序设计 测试 分享交流
阶段一:连接电路
1. 将 Arduino 开发板和马达驱动板与小车连接。
Arduino 开发板直接插入马达驱动板即可实现两者的连接。注意:Arduino 开发板和马
达的引脚已经固定,方向控制脚是 4、12、8、7,速度控制脚是 3、11、5、6。本活动需
两个马达,选择 M1 和 M2。编写程序时,用 4、12、3、11 四个引脚。
69

